Benin - Poultry Meat Production
Since 2014, Benin Poultry Meat Production rose 2.7% year on year. At 14,691 Metric Tons in 2019, the country was number 136 among other countries in Poultry Meat Production. Benin is overtaken by Liberia, which was ranked number 135 with 14,986 Metric Tons and is followed by Guinea with 13,730 Metric Tons. United States topped the ranking with 22,539,206.32 Metric Tons in 2019, +1.1% versus 2018. China, Brazil and Russia resp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Bhutan recorded the best 5 years average growth at +19.8% per year, while Uruguay witnessed the worst performance at -16.5% per year.
